SaaS In A DevOps Engineer Job
Introduction to the Importance of SaaS Skills in DevOps
Software as a Service (SaaS) is a delivery model that has transformed the way enterprises consume software applications. In the context of a DevOps engineers role, SaaS entails the skills needed to develop, deploy, manage, and scale cloud applications that are delivered over the internet. Mastering SaaS skills is highly valuable in the job market, as they enable engineers to efficiently collaborate with cross-functional teams and maintain high-availability services that businesses depend on. The importance of SaaS skills cannot be overstated, as they are integral to modern IT operations and service delivery. Understanding SaaS is crucial for any DevOps engineer aiming to excel in their career.
Understanding Skill Context and Variations in SaaS for DevOps
In various job roles, the SaaS skill set leverages cloud-native technologies and continuous integration/continuous deployment (CI/CD) pipelines to deliver software updates. From healthcare to finance, every industry is increasingly dependent on SaaS applications, which necessitates experienced DevOps engineers who can navigate the complexities of cloud platform services. At the entry-level, an understanding of basic cloud services and deployment models is expected. Mid-level DevOps Engineers with SaaS skills are expected to implement and manage CI/CD pipelines and monitor the health of cloud services. Senior engineers are responsible for architecting scalable SaaS solutions and leading DevOps strategies across the enterprise.
Real-World Applications and Scenarios of SaaS in DevOps
Examples of SaaS in DevOps include the deployment of enterprise-level applications such as CRM systems on platforms like Salesforce, or productivity suites like Google Workspace. Netflix, a leading streamer, uses a SaaS model to deploy its services globally, with DevOps practices at the heart of its operation, ensuring seamless content delivery. Mastery of SaaS skills has led to notable successes, such as a DevOps engineer at a major tech company automating the delivery pipeline, significantly reducing the time-to-market for new features and enhancing system reliability. These real-world applications highlight the critical role of SaaS in modern DevOps practices. For more insights, you can explore Workflows in a DevOps Engineer Job.
Showcasing Your Skill and Expertise in SaaS for DevOps
Demonstrate your SaaS skills to potential employers by contributing to open-source SaaS projects on platforms like GitHub. Acquiring certifications like AWS Certified DevOps Engineer – Professional or Microsoft Certified: Azure DevOps Engineer Expert can also validate your expertise. Highlighting your involvement in significant projects and your ability to manage cloud services effectively can set you apart. Additionally, showcasing your knowledge of related skills such as Web Services in a DevOps Engineer Job can further enhance your profile. Employers look for candidates who can demonstrate practical experience and a deep understanding of SaaS in DevOps.
Exploring Career Pathways and Opportunities with SaaS Skills
Skilled DevOps Engineers with SaaS expertise are in demand for roles such as Cloud Architect, Automation Specialist, and Site Reliability Engineer among others. Complementary skills include knowledge of scripting languages such as Python, use of containerization technologies like Docker, and orchestration tools such as Kubernetes. These skills can open doors to various career opportunities and allow for career growth within the tech industry. Understanding the broader context of SaaS in DevOps can also lead to roles in project management and strategic planning. For more information on related skills, check out VMware in a DevOps Engineer Job.
Insights from Industry Experts on SaaS in DevOps
As the industry shifts towards microservices and serverless architectures, the significance of SaaS knowledge in DevOps has never been more important. Industry experts emphasize the need for a broader understanding of cloud-native solutions and service mesh technologies. Staying updated with the latest trends and best practices is crucial for maintaining relevance in the field. Engaging with thought leaders and participating in industry forums can provide valuable insights. For additional perspectives, consider exploring Vendor Management in a DevOps Engineer Job.
Looking to build a resume that will help you compete in today’s tough job market? Jobalope’s resume tool will analyze your resume and any job description and tell you exactly how to take it to the next level.
Current Trends and Developments in SaaS for DevOps
The industry is witnessing a shift towards microservices and serverless architectures, making SaaS knowledge increasingly critical. The SaaS skill in a DevOps engineer job description is adapting to encompass a broader understanding of cloud-native solutions and service mesh technologies. Staying abreast of these trends can provide a competitive edge in the job market. Additionally, the integration of AI and machine learning into SaaS platforms is becoming more prevalent, offering new opportunities for innovation. For more on related trends, visit UX in a DevOps Engineer Job.
Measuring Proficiency and Progress in SaaS Skills
Self-assessment tools such as online quizzes and practical scenario-based tasks can help evaluate your SaaS expertise. Performance metrics in real-life projects may also serve as indicators of proficiency. Regularly reviewing your skills and seeking feedback from peers can provide insights into areas for improvement. Participating in hackathons and coding challenges can also help measure your progress. For additional resources, consider exploring Unix in a DevOps Engineer Job.
Certification and Endorsements for SaaS Skills in DevOps
Obtaining certifications like AWS Certified DevOps Engineer or Microsoft Certified: Azure DevOps Engineer Expert can validate your expertise. These certifications are recognized by employers and can enhance your credibility in the job market. Additionally, endorsements from industry professionals on platforms like LinkedIn can further bolster your profile. Engaging in continuous learning and obtaining additional certifications can keep your skills up-to-date. For more on certifications, visit Troubleshooting in a DevOps Engineer Job.
Maintaining and Updating Your SaaS Skills in DevOps
Stay updated by following DevOps-focused blogs, attending cloud technology webinars, and participating in community forums. Regularly reviewing industry publications and engaging with thought leaders can provide valuable insights. Participating in online courses and workshops can also help keep your skills current. Networking with other professionals in the field can provide opportunities for knowledge sharing and collaboration. For more resources, check out DevOps.com and AWS DevOps Blog.
Conclusion and Next Steps for Mastering SaaS Skills in DevOps
To recap, the SaaS skill in a DevOps engineer job description plays a crucial role in the modern IT landscape, and its demand is only growing. If you aspire to excel in this field, start by deepening your cloud knowledge, gain practical experience through projects, and consider obtaining relevant certifications. Experiment with deploying a simple application on a cloud platform. Connect with other DevOps professionals on LinkedIn to share insights. Join local DevOps meetups to network and learn from peers. For more actionable steps, explore Technical Support in a DevOps Engineer Job.
Jobalope can you help you customize the perfect cover letter for any job – add your resume and the job description to our cover letter generator and you’ll get a personalized output to wow any hiring manager.
Category and Job
Skills
- .NET in a DevOps Engineer Job
- Algorithms in a DevOps Engineer Job
- Android in a DevOps Engineer Job
- Architecture in a DevOps Engineer Job
- Architectures in a DevOps Engineer Job
- AutoCAD in a DevOps Engineer Job
- AWS in a DevOps Engineer Job
- Big data in a DevOps Engineer Job
- Business analysis in a DevOps Engineer Job
- Business continuity in a DevOps Engineer Job
- C (programming language) in a DevOps Engineer Job
- C# (sharp) in a DevOps Engineer Job
- C++ in a DevOps Engineer Job
- CAD in a DevOps Engineer Job
- Certification in a DevOps Engineer Job
- Cisco in a DevOps Engineer Job
- Cloud in a DevOps Engineer Job
- Compliance in a DevOps Engineer Job
- Computer applications in a DevOps Engineer Job
- Computer science in a DevOps Engineer Job
- Controls in a DevOps Engineer Job
- CSS in a DevOps Engineer Job
- D (programming language) in a DevOps Engineer Job
- Data center in a DevOps Engineer Job
- Data collection in a DevOps Engineer Job
- Data entry in a DevOps Engineer Job
- Data management in a DevOps Engineer Job
- Database management in a DevOps Engineer Job
- Datasets in a DevOps Engineer Job
- Design in a DevOps Engineer Job
- Development activities in a DevOps Engineer Job
- Digital marketing in a DevOps Engineer Job
- Digital media in a DevOps Engineer Job
- Distribution in a DevOps Engineer Job
- DNS in a DevOps Engineer Job
- Ecommerce in a DevOps Engineer Job
- E-commerce in a DevOps Engineer Job
- End user in a DevOps Engineer Job
- Experimental in a DevOps Engineer Job
- Experiments in a DevOps Engineer Job
- Frameworks in a DevOps Engineer Job
- Front-end in a DevOps Engineer Job
- GIS in a DevOps Engineer Job
- Graphic design in a DevOps Engineer Job
- Hardware in a DevOps Engineer Job
- HTML5 in a DevOps Engineer Job
- I-DEAS in a DevOps Engineer Job
- Information management in a DevOps Engineer Job
- Information security in a DevOps Engineer Job
- Information technology in a DevOps Engineer Job
- Intranet in a DevOps Engineer Job
- IOS in a DevOps Engineer Job
- IPhone in a DevOps Engineer Job
- IT infrastructure in a DevOps Engineer Job
- ITIL in a DevOps Engineer Job
- Java in a DevOps Engineer Job
- JavaScript in a DevOps Engineer Job
- JIRA in a DevOps Engineer Job
- LAN in a DevOps Engineer Job
- Licensing in a DevOps Engineer Job
- Linux in a DevOps Engineer Job
- Machine learning in a DevOps Engineer Job
- MATLAB in a DevOps Engineer Job
- Matrix in a DevOps Engineer Job
- Mechanical engineering in a DevOps Engineer Job
- Migration in a DevOps Engineer Job
- Mobile in a DevOps Engineer Job
- Modeling in a DevOps Engineer Job
- Networking in a DevOps Engineer Job
- Operations management in a DevOps Engineer Job
- Oracle in a DevOps Engineer Job
- OS in a DevOps Engineer Job
- Process development in a DevOps Engineer Job
- Process improvements in a DevOps Engineer Job
- Product design in a DevOps Engineer Job
- Product development in a DevOps Engineer Job
- Product knowledge in a DevOps Engineer Job
- Program management in a DevOps Engineer Job
- Programming in a DevOps Engineer Job
- Protocols in a DevOps Engineer Job
- Prototype in a DevOps Engineer Job
- Python in a DevOps Engineer Job
- Quality assurance in a DevOps Engineer Job
- Real-time in a DevOps Engineer Job
- Research in a DevOps Engineer Job
- Resource management in a DevOps Engineer Job
- Root cause in a DevOps Engineer Job
- Routing in a DevOps Engineer Job
- SaaS in a DevOps Engineer Job
- SAS in a DevOps Engineer Job
- SCI in a DevOps Engineer Job
- Scripting in a DevOps Engineer Job
- Scrum in a DevOps Engineer Job
- SDLC in a DevOps Engineer Job
- SEO in a DevOps Engineer Job
- Service delivery in a DevOps Engineer Job
- Software development in a DevOps Engineer Job
- Software development life cycle in a DevOps Engineer Job
- Software engineering in a DevOps Engineer Job
- SQL in a DevOps Engineer Job
- SQL server in a DevOps Engineer Job
- Tablets in a DevOps Engineer Job
- Technical in a DevOps Engineer Job
- Technical issues in a DevOps Engineer Job
- Technical knowledge in a DevOps Engineer Job
- Technical skills in a DevOps Engineer Job
- Technical support in a DevOps Engineer Job
- Test cases in a DevOps Engineer Job
- Test plans in a DevOps Engineer Job
- Testing in a DevOps Engineer Job
- Troubleshooting in a DevOps Engineer Job
- UI in a DevOps Engineer Job
- Unix in a DevOps Engineer Job
- Usability in a DevOps Engineer Job
- User experience in a DevOps Engineer Job
- UX in a DevOps Engineer Job
- Variances in a DevOps Engineer Job
- Vendor management in a DevOps Engineer Job
- VMware in a DevOps Engineer Job
- Web services in a DevOps Engineer Job
- Workflows in a DevOps Engineer Job